Web9 hours ago · 1) Set Hostname and Install Updates. Open the terminal of your server and set the hostname using hostnamectl command, $ sudo hostnamectl set-hostname "ipa.linuxtechi.lan" $ exec bash. Install updates using yum/dnf command and then reboot it. $ sudo dnf update -y $ sudo reboot. WebOct 14, 2024 · With Chrony installed, we will have to enable its daemons service to start at boot automatically. While we are at it, we will also start the service up to get Chrony running immediately. The daemon is what will run in the background and update your Linux device’s time with NTP servers. sudo systemctl enable chrony sudo systemctl start chrony. 3. WebDec 6, 2024 · How to Restart a Service. To stop and restart the service in Linux, use the command: sudo systemctl restart SERVICE_NAME. After this point, your service should be up and running again. You can verify the state with the status command. To restart Apache server use: sudo systemctl restart apache2. small flower spray
